Signal Boost: Ace is the Place · 3:56am Sep 19th, 2021

Have you ever wondered what it might be like if a store were staffed by ponies but managed by a human? Good news, you don’t have to wonder any further; Buck Swisher has a story about helpful hardware store ponies.

EAce Is The Place
Ace is the place with the helpful hardware...ponies?
Buck Swisher · 3k words  ·  142  16 · 1.9k views

And it’s on Earth, so that easily ticks both boxes in the Not-A-Contest rules.

While I have pondered a story involving a human manager at a pony store, that concept hasn’t really gotten off of the ground. Having said that, even on Earth with an Earth-brand store, I could imagine that the clash of pony culture and human culture could cause all sorts of problems, and require a capable manager to tread lightly. This story is set in late-stage capitalist America, as it plainly points out early on:

"Great!" said Dan. "Does this mean I get a raise?"

"Nope!" replied Fred. "Not in America! Have a good day!"

And if that weren’t enough on the nose . . .

Dan realized that these ponies knew nothing about standard American workplace values.

At the end of the day, though, it’s a relatable story, sort of like The Office but better because it has ponies.


Source

It’s also highly relatable, to be honest. Perhaps painfully so.
